  • The Indesit Aria IDD 6340 IX Double Oven in white, bringing great capacity and a co-ordinated modern design to your home. Enjoy 74L of cooking space in the main cavity, perfect for making big family meals and with the power of fan assistance, dishes are evenly heated with less hot and cold pockets. Grill kit: all the equipment you need to start grilling right away. 3 multifunctions: pre-setting programmes takes the guess work out of cooking. Overview: Programmable digital display timer. Slow cook function. Defrost function. Main cavity: Multifunction cavity with 1 shelf. 74 litre capacity. Interior light. Easy-clean enamel. Energy efficiency rating A. Energy consumption 0.92kWh. Second cavity: Multifunction cavity with 1 shelf. 42 litre capacity. Energy efficiency rating A. Energy consumption 0.99kWh. Grill: Combined with top oven. Dimensions: Oven size H88.7, W59.7, D57.7cm. Oven to fit aperture (space required H88.7, W59.7, D57.7cm). General information: Oven needs to be hard wired into a cooker point on the wall and on its own circuit. Manufacturers 10 year parts and 1 year labour guarantee.
